Citing sources in a specific way is not mandatory at St. Joseph's Elementary
School, however using basic MLA guidelines is recommended. Here are some
examples:
Steps for Books (Basic)
1. Author's name.
2. Title of book.
3. Place of publication, name of publisher, date of publication.
No author
Star Trek: a behind the scenes look at science fictions best.
Edington, California: Lewis Publications, 2004.
Single author
Ried, Lori. Your guide to dreams. Markham, Ontario: Scholastic,
1999.
Two authors
Dewey, Melvil and Kieth Walsh. The library: heaven on earth.
Oromocto, New Brunswick: Waterville Press, 1999.
More than two authors
Eberts, Marjoirie, et al. Careers for financial mavens and other
movers. Lincolnwood, Illinois: VGM Career Horizons, 2003.
